Abstract

The invention discloses a flushable external-pressure ultrafiltration filter element assembly and a water purifier, wherein the ultrafiltration filter element assembly comprises a filter shell and a filter element arranged in the filter shell, a raw water main inlet is arranged at the water inlet end of the filter shell, a purified water main outlet and a sewage discharge main outlet are arranged at the water outlet end of the filter shell, the filter element comprises a water purification chamber and hollow fiber ultrafiltration membrane filaments, the wall of the water purification chamber is provided with the raw water inlet, the purified water outlet and the sewage discharge outlet, the tube orifice at one end of the hollow fiber ultrafiltration membrane filaments is closed, the tube orifice at the other end is communicated with the purified water outlet, a water purification cavity is arranged between the water purification chamber and an end cover at the water outlet end of the filter shell, and the water; a sewage cavity is also arranged between the water purifying chamber and the end cover at the water outlet end of the filter shell, the sewage cavity is positioned at one side of the water purifying cavity back to the water purifying chamber, and the sewage cavity is communicated with the sewage discharge outlet and the main sewage discharge outlet. The washable external-pressure ultrafiltration filter element assembly can prolong the service life of the filter element, increase the total water purification amount and reduce the use cost of consumers.

Background technology
At present ultra-filtration element divides two kinds of inner pressed and external-compression types.The inner pressed ultra-filtration element has flushable structure, can repeatedly rinse long service life; But the easy spalling of inner pressed ultra-filtration element, safe drinking water can not get sufficient assurance.The external-compression type ultra-filtration element does not have the danger of hollow fiber film yarn fracture, but does not possess flushable structure, or need to add recoil valve, adds automatically controlledly just can rinse, and only needs water pressure enough to get final product during milipore filter work, powers up and seems very burdensome.
China more American-European Japan and Korea S of water quality etc. countries is poor, and in water, impurity is than many 30% left and right of Japan and other countries, and milipore filter has easy polluting property, minimizing sharply in service life under poor water quality environment.Ultra-filtration element standard water amount is 2t (current technology), and experiment at present and actual the use are generally the 1.5t left and right, in the situation that water quality is severe less than 1t from the beginning.
At present, washable filter element can effectively increase total water purification amount, extends filter element life, avoids frequently more renew cartridge, reduce consumer's use cost, but developing result is not very desirable.

Described filter core 200 comprises the water purifying chamber 240 be formed in described filter housing 100 and the many hollow fiber film yarns 230 that are placed in this water purifying chamber 240, the blowdown outlet 222 that is provided with the original water inlet 211 be communicated with described former water general import 121, the pure water inlet 221 be communicated with described water purification general export 131 on the wall of described water purifying chamber 240 and is communicated with described blowdown general export 132, the mouth of pipe sealing of described hollow fiber film yarn 230 1 ends, the other end mouth of pipe is communicated with described pure water inlet 221; Be provided with separate water-purifying cavity 310 and soil chamber 320 between the end cap of described water purifying chamber 240 and described filter housing 100 water sides, described water-purifying cavity 310 is near described water purifying chamber 240, and be communicated with described pure water inlet 221 and described water purification general export 131, described soil chamber 320 is away from water purifying chamber 240, and is communicated with described blowdown outlet 222 and described blowdown general export 132.Running water enters in water purifying chamber 240 from former water general import 121, original water inlet 211, under the pressure-acting of running water, hydrone sees through hollow fiber film yarn 230, and flows to water side by the inner tube of film silk, and impurity is blocked in water purifying chamber 240 inside by hollow fiber film yarn 230.When rinsing, flush switch 400 is opened, and because the blowdown resistance to flow output is few, hollow fiber film yarn 230 resistances are large, and most of current export and go out by blowdown, take away the impurity that water processed stays, and reach the effect of washing hollow-fiber ultrafiltration membrane filaments 230.The water purification that filter core 200 is made is collected in water-purifying cavity 310, by water purification general export 131, discharges, and the wastewater collection produced during filter core 200 blowdown, in soil chamber 320, is flowed out by blowdown general export 132.The Main Function of soil chamber 320 is that sewage is focused on to a place, so, water purification and sewage are separated and come, the distance of hollow fiber film yarn and pollutant has strengthened simultaneously, hollow fiber film yarn is away from pollutant, reduced pollutant and refluxed and again pollute the risk of hollow fiber film yarn.

Preferably, described blowdown outlet 222 is more than two.Further preferred, described blowdown outlet 222 is three, and three blowdown outlet 222 edges centered by the geometric center of described the second end socket 220 are circumferentially uniform.Adopt the beneficial effect of plural blowdown outlet 222 to be: because each flushing can't be as so thorough in ideal, after each the flushing, the blowdown exit has accumulation of pollutants, adding the blowdown export volume by increase can disperse deposit more, just equal to have increased comparatively speaking washing time, make blowdown more thorough, improve developing result.
